I'm running a 2310 with a basic DNS/DHCP LAN configuration. I'm able to access systems using host name over NFS OK, but I also use VNC for remote desktop management. The host name is not resolving in VNC, forcing me to use IP addresses which is a hassle.
Is there a switch or configuration in the router to force DNS resolution, or am I going to have to configure a dedicated DNS server so that this may work?

I guess like most routers of this price category your model only supports DNS relaying and distributing DNS server addresses to LAN clients via DHCP (either its own LAN interface address when configured to work as DNS relay or otherwise the addresses of external DNS servers either received dynamically by your ISP during Internet connection setup or configured manually if you don't want to use your ISP's DNS servers). And may be it supports DynDNS to register its global WAN IP address with a DynDNS provider of your choice.
But that's it. It will probably not support local name resolution by establishing local DNS zones for forward and reverse lookup of the names and addresses of your LAN devices within a local domain name of your choice (e.g. "homelan.local") including dynamic DNS registration for your LAN devices required due to the dynamic address configuration via DHCP. To provide this you probably have to install a dedicated DNS server hosting your local zones and configured with DNS forwarders (either your EBR-2310 when configured as DNS relay or external DNS servers) for resolving names in the Internet.
With a static IP configuration of your LAN devices (at least those you want to resolve by name) you can also work with a HOSTS file distributed amongst all relevant LAN devices which shall be able to do local name resolution.

... no resolution outside of setting up a private DNS and that's a mess in itself.
Unfortunately you didn't tell which operating systems your LAN clients use. If you are using Windows you could activate and use NetBIOS name resolution instead of DNS, since according to the VNC knowledge base (http://kb.realvnc.com/questions/112/I%27m+receiving+the+error+%22The+requested+name+is+valid%2C+but+no+data+of+the+requested+type+was+found+%2811004%29.%22) VNC software does not directly perform any type of Name Resolution, but simply asks the operating system to resolve names on its behalf.
You can test if NetBIOS name resolution works by typing nbtstat -a <COMPUTER> within a command prompt, where <COMPUTER> has to be replaced by the name of another computer within your LAN (lowercase "a" is significant, uppercase "A" has a different meaning!). If successful the command shows the NetBIOS name table of <COMPUTER>, and then typing the command nbtstat -c would reveal the IPv4 address <COMPUTER> was resolved to via NetBIOS name resolution.
